Up to 100 jobs are thought to be at risk from Premier Oil’s plans to terminate vessel owner Teekay’s contract for a North Sea field.
But talks with operator Hibiscus about redeploying the vessel to the Malaysian firm’s Marigold field, offshore UK, has provided a glimpse of hope.
Premier Oil has served Teekay with notice to remove the Voyageur floating production, storage and offloading (FPSO) vessel from the Huntington field, according to the minutes of a”townhall” meeting seen by Energy Voice.
